How they compare

Dominica currently reports 0.69 kg CO2eq/Int$ against 0.68 kg CO2eq/Int$ in China, mainland, a difference of 0.01 kg CO2eq/Int$.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1990 it was China, mainland ahead.

China, mainland ranks 158th and Dominica ranks 156th of 184 countries.

China, mainland has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ade China, mainland Dominica Difference Ahead
1990s 1.53 kg CO2eq/Int$ 0.825 kg CO2eq/Int$ 0.708 kg CO2eq/Int$ China, mainland
2000s 1.06 kg CO2eq/Int$ 0.841 kg CO2eq/Int$ 0.218 kg CO2eq/Int$ China, mainland
2010s 0.798 kg CO2eq/Int$ 0.728 kg CO2eq/Int$ 0.07 kg CO2eq/Int$ China, mainland
2020s 0.705 kg CO2eq/Int$ 0.695 kg CO2eq/Int$ 0.01 kg CO2eq/Int$ China, mainland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ions indicators disseminates indicators on sectoral shares of total national gre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ions as well as three indicators of emissions intensity: per capita emissions; emissions per value of agricultural production; and emissions per area of agricultural land.
